Latest Patents
Niraj holds a patent for an "Edge computing assisted vehicle alerting system and methods." This patent outlines systems and methods for implementing edge computing-assisted vehicle alerts. The technology involves a multi-access edge computing (MEC) server that can obtain multiple messages from various vehicles. It determines the formation of a traffic queue based on these messages and establishes zone-based speed limits. The system can also identify when a vehicle approaching the traffic queue is traveling faster than desired, generating alerts to improve safety.
